Middle Eastern Cookery by Robin Howe is a comprehensive exploration of the culinary traditions of the Middle East, published by Eyre Methuen in 1978. This first edition, written in English and spanning 189 pages, presents a variety of recipes and cooking techniques that reflect the rich and diverse flavors of the region. The book aims to provide readers with an understanding of Middle Eastern cooking, showcasing its unique ingredients and methods.

Readers will find a detailed presentation of various dishes that highlight the cultural significance of Middle Eastern cuisine. The book covers a range of cooking styles and regional specialties, making it a valuable resource for anyone interested in exploring this vibrant culinary landscape. With a focus on regional and ethnic cooking, Middle Eastern Cookery serves as both a practical guide and an informative reference for those looking to expand their culinary repertoire.
